What companies run services between Royal Victoria Dock, England and Shadwell DLR, England?

Dockland Light Railway (DLR) operates a train from Pontoon Dock DLR Station to Shadwell DLR every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£2–3 and the journey takes 16 min. Alternatively, Stagecoach London operates a bus from Chauntler Close / Cundy Park to Tobacco Dock hourly. Tickets cost £2 and the journey takes 22 min.
